Dr. David Pietraszewski is Assistant Professor in the Department of Psychological and Brain Sciences at the University of California, Santa Barbara. He is an experimental psychologist who applies evolutionary theorizing to Social, Cognitive, and Developmental questions. He is particularly interested in characterizing the psychology of multi-agent conflict and cooperation ("coalitional psychology").

This is our second interview. You can watch the first one (Modularity of Mind, Coalitional Psychology, and Politics), here: youtu.be/5v1qKir4nKE

In this episode, we start by talking about alliance membership and race categorization. We discuss intergroup conflict, peace, and reconciliation from an evolutionary perspective. We talk about how the human mind represents social groups. We discuss what cognitive processes are. We talk about the free will debate. We discuss David Pinsof and Martie Haselton’s alliance theory of political belief systems. Finally, we talk about difference detecting mechanisms, and the influence they have on the science of psychology.
